The present appeal is filed by the Assessee against the order of Ld. Commissioner of Income Tax (Appeals/ National Faceless Appeal Centre (‘Ld. CIT(A)/NFAC’ for short), New Delhi dated 17/03/2025 for the Assessment Year 2019-20.

2. Brief facts of the case are that, the assessee filed its return of income for the A.Y.2019-20 having gross total income of Rs. 79,44,337/-. During the processing of ITR u/s. 143(1)(a), the CPC had disallowed Rs. 33,02,357/- on account of delay in payment of employees share of ESI and PF.
